I put the multimeter on the 12v car powercord and get 5v, but the led will not light up. Is this fixable for less than $10. ?
Orginal whistler power cords do not have LEDs lights in them and there is no electronics in the plug - 12 volts in, 12 volts out. Sounds like you have a bad cord or a cord that is meant for a GPS unit or other 5 volt device.
